Browns Mill Village: A New Model for Affordable Homeownership

November 5, 2025

Browns Mill Village stands as a milestone in Atlanta Habitat’s history, our largest development to date and a shining example of what’s possible when innovation, collaboration, and community come together.

Developed in partnership with Cityscape Housing, Browns Mill Village is a thoughtfully designed mixed-income neighborhood located on 31.4 acres just south of downtown Atlanta in the Orchard Knob area. This vibrant community combines affordable homeownership with beautiful natural surroundings, recreation areas, and neighborhood amenities that promote connection, wellness, and long-term sustainability.

Surrounded by local treasures such as Browns Mill Golf Course, the Urban Food Forest, and the 211-acre Southside Park Nature Preserve, Browns Mill Village offers residents the convenience of city access with the comfort and safety of a true neighborhood.

Browns Mill Village marks Atlanta Habitat’s first planned development joint venture with a for-profit builder — a groundbreaking partnership that has expanded our capacity to deliver high-quality, affordable homes on a larger scale.

This development introduced three new floor plans, Atlanta Habitat’s first model homes, and a fresh approach to community planning that balances design, sustainability, and affordability. With 134 total homesites, Browns Mill Village includes:

  • 75 single-family homes built by Atlanta Habitat, featuring 3–4 bedrooms across single and two-story craftsman-style floor plans (1,400–1,600 SF)
  • 59 townhomes developed by Cityscape Housing and Atlanta Neighborhood Development Partnership, offering additional affordable homeownership opportunities

Every home reflects our commitment to quality, energy efficiency, and timeless design, ensuring long-term affordability and pride of ownership for generations to come.

A Connected, Convenient Community

Less than five miles from downtown Atlanta, Browns Mill Village offers quick access to Interstates 75 and 85 and Hartsfield-Jackson International Airport, while maintaining the quiet character and greenery of a residential neighborhood.

The 1.5-acre central park serves as the heart of the community and is complete with walking paths and natural landscapes. Additional amenities include:

  • A soccer pitch sponsored by LISC and Atlanta United, which doubles as an innovative stormwater retention feature
  • Thoughtful landscaping and walkable streets that promote wellness, safety, and connection

Affordable HOA dues maintain the neighborhood’s shared spaces, ensuring a clean, cohesive environment and protecting home values for years to come.

Making Homeownership Possible

Atlanta Habitat homebuyers at Browns Mill Village enjoy interest-free 30-year mortgages starting at $750/month, making homeownership attainable for working families across metro Atlanta.

Through partnerships with local sponsors, donors, and volunteers, this development demonstrates the power of community investment to create generational impact.

Looking Ahead to Langston Park

Inspired by the success of Browns Mill Village, Atlanta Habitat will launch a new development in 2025: Langston Park in Sylvan Hills. This community will offer a broader mix of affordable housing options, including 2-, 4-, and 6-unit townhomes alongside single-family homes.

Designed with modern exterior elements, these homes will resemble our current two-story model, with the primary difference being shared walls for townhome units. Future phases will also introduce 2- and 3-story townhomes with 3- or 4-bedroom layouts, expanding homeownership opportunities for more Atlanta families.

Langston Park represents the next chapter in Atlanta Habitat’s work to create innovative, sustainable neighborhoods across the city.
